
The Somali National Army, in collaboration with courageous local fighters, has released images and footage of vehicles abandoned by the Al-Shabaab militants. The vehicles were deliberately concealed under tree branches in an attempt to hide them following a series of direct attacks and airstrikes that targeted Al-Shabaab leaders and fighters in recent days.
Fleeing militants left behind the vehicles and a large cache of weapons in the bushy border areas between Hiiraan and Middle Shabelle regions. The retreat reflects a growing sense of defeat and disarray within Al-Shabaab ranks, as they were unable to withstand the intensified military pressure.
According to military officials, the swift action of the joint forces led to the discovery and seizure of the abandoned vehicles and weapons, which Al-Shabaab had attempted to bury or hide in remote forested areas.
This latest success is further evidence of the ongoing collapse of Al-Shabaab’s operational capabilities. The seized equipment has been transferred to secure military facilities for further investigation and security assessment.
